Charles “Meat Man” Meeks

Ok….so I’ve already posted this in the bass forum, but when I was in High school, and just learning bass, I became a huge fan of Chuck Mangione. My mom loved “Feels So Good” and I kinda like that song too. My buddy, and fellow Screamin Eagle bandmate, Brent Clark, was a Mangione freak thoughm and introduced me to “Live at the Hollywood Bowl”. This album blew my mind, and introduced me to the bass work of Charles “Meat Man” Meeks, and the drumming of James Bradley Jr.

 

This is one of the first Bass solos I ever learned note for note. Love his tone, and especially his vibrato, something I still do when playing a bass solo.

 

That is clearly a Stingray, BTW…

Support your local stores

There are a great number of mom’n'pop music stores all around the country. You may find good deals online, or at big-box super stores, but don’t forget to spend some of your money locally.

I’ve purchased all my equipment recently at a place local here called Five Star Guitars. The owner is great, and the employees really know their stuff. You can often find great deals on consigned gear at these little shops and their SERVICE is always top notch.

It’s nice being called by name when going in to a place.
